Geography

Rajarhat is located at 25.8000°N 89.5500°E . It has 27357 units of house hold and total area 166.23 km².

Administrative

Rajarhat has 7 Unions, 110 Mauzas/Mahallas, and 180 villages. The name of the unions are appended below:

1. Rajarhat
2. Chakirpasha
3. Nazimkhan
4. Biddanand
5. Umarmajid
6. Sinai
7. Ghorialdanga
